奋斗
努力

深度学习服务器一般是什么配置?

云计算

深度学习服务器一般是什么配置?

结论

深度学习服务器通常配备高性能的多核CPU、大容量的内存、多块高端GPU、高速存储设备和强大的网络连接。这些配置共同确保了深度学习任务的高效运行,包括数据处理、模型训练和推理。具体来说,常见的配置包括:

  • CPU:多核心(如16核或更多)的高性能处理器,如Intel Xeon或AMD EPYC。
  • 内存:至少128GB DDR4或DDR5内存,以支持大规模数据集和复杂模型。
  • GPU:多块高端GPU,如NVIDIA A100、V100或RTX 3090,每块GPU至少16GB显存。
  • 存储:高速SSD,如NVMe SSD,总容量在1TB以上,用于快速读取和写入数据。
  • 网络:千兆或万兆以太网,确保数据传输的高效性。

分析探讨

1. CPU

深度学习任务虽然主要依赖于GPU进行并行计算,但CPU在数据预处理、模型加载和管理等方面仍然扮演着重要角色。因此,选择高性能的多核CPU是必要的。常见的选择包括:

  • Intel Xeon:多核心、高频率的处理器,适用于多种计算任务。
  • AMD EPYC:同样多核心,但在某些场景下能提供更高的性价比。

这些处理器通常具备较高的缓存容量和内存带宽,能够有效提升数据处理速度。

2. 内存

深度学习模型往往需要处理大规模的数据集,因此大容量的内存是必不可少的。至少128GB的DDR4或DDR5内存可以满足大多数需求,对于更大规模的模型和数据集,可能需要256GB甚至更高。大容量内存可以减少数据交换到磁盘的频率,提高整体效率。

3. GPU

GPU是深度学习服务器的核心组件,负责执行大量的并行计算任务。常见的高端GPU包括:

  • NVIDIA A100:目前最顶级的GPU之一,具有40GB或80GB的显存,适用于大规模模型训练。
  • NVIDIA V100:同样高性能,32GB显存,广泛应用于科研和工业界。
  • NVIDIA RTX 3090:消费级高端GPU,24GB显存,适合预算有限但性能要求较高的场景。

多块GPU通过NVLink或PCIe连接,可以进一步提升计算能力,实现更高效的并行计算。

4. 存储

高速存储设备对于快速读取和写入数据至关重要。常见的选择包括:

  • NVMe SSD:读写速度远超传统SATA SSD,适用于频繁的数据访问。
  • 企业级HDD:虽然读写速度较慢,但容量大且成本较低,适用于数据备份和归档。

总容量通常在1TB以上,根据实际需求可以选择更大的容量。

5. 网络

强大的网络连接确保数据传输的高效性,特别是在分布式训练和数据传输场景中。常见的选择包括:

  • 千兆以太网:基本配置,适用于大多数场景。
  • 万兆以太网:更高的带宽,适用于大规模分布式训练和数据密集型应用。

此外,InfiniBand等高性能网络技术也可以考虑,但成本较高。

综合考量

在选择深度学习服务器的配置时,还需要综合考虑以下几个因素:

  • 预算:高端配置成本较高,需要根据项目预算进行权衡。
  • 应用场景:不同的应用场景对硬件的需求不同,例如,研究机构可能需要更高性能的GPU,而企业可能更注重成本效益。
  • 扩展性:未来的扩展需求也是选择配置时需要考虑的因素,确保服务器能够适应未来的发展。

综上所述,深度学习服务器的配置需要根据具体需求进行选择,但高性能的多核CPU、大容量内存、多块高端GPU、高速存储设备和强大的网络连接是确保高效运行的基础。

未经允许不得转载:云服务器 » 深度学习服务器一般是什么配置?